What do you tell vegetarians??
Missy
Hi Missy-
Good question. I’ve been experimenting with the “buttery sticks” and “natural shortening” made by Earth Balance. Recipes can be adapted for vegetarians and those who are dairy free. There are probably some other options out there and I’d love to hear what others are using.
Kate
Kate
I’ve used the Organic Spectrum “shortening” from PCC. Yes, it’s solid like that dirty word called Crisco but it isn’t hydrogenated. When I asked PCC if they sold lard this is what they recommended because they don’t sell lard. I’ve been using it for years so it wasn’t really news to me when they suggested it.
